R-6111 . . r RESOLUTION6111 (CCS) (City Council Ser1es) A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SANTA MONICA DECLARING ITS INTENTION TO CONSTRUCT GUTTERS ALONG PORTIONS OF ARIZONA AVENUE, ALL WITHIN THE CITY OF SANTA MONICA. WHEREAS, the Clty Counc11 of the City of Santa Monica is empowered by Sect10n 5870, et seq. of the Streets and Highways Code of the State of California to construct gutters at various locations w1thin the City of Santa Monica' NOW, THEREFORE, TH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SANTA MONICA DOES RESOLVE AS FOLLOWS: SECTION 1. That the public interest requires and 1t 1S the 1ntent10n of the City Council of the City of Santa Mon1ca to order the following work to be done, to W1t. The construction of concrete gutters along Ar1zona Avenue between 19th Court and 20th Street between 22nd Street and 22nd Court. The estimated assessment cost of the 1mprovement is $8.50 per front foot. SECTION 2. That said proposed work or improvement in the opinion of the City Council of the City of Santa Monica is of more than local or ord1nary public benefit, and said Council hereby proposes that the district 1n the City of Santa Monica to be benefited by said work or improvement and to be assessed to pay the cost and expense thereof, includes all of the commercially-zoned property abutting Arizona Avenue between 19th Court and 20th Street between 22nd Street and 22nd Court. -1- . . SECTION 3. Notlce hereby is glven pursuant to said Section 5870 et seq. that on November 25, 1980, at the hour of 7:30 p.m. 1n the Counc11 Chambers ln the City Hall of sa1d C1ty of Santa Mon1ca, situated at 1685 Main Street 1n said City, any and all persons having any objections to the proposed work or improvement may appear before the City Council and show cause why the said proposed work or improvement should not be carried out in accordance with said Resolution of Intent1on. SECTION 4. The Superintendent of Streets immediately shall cause to be conspicuously posted along the llne of said contemplated 1mprovement not1ce of the passage of this Resolution of Intention in the manner and form prescr1bed by law. The C1ty Clerk hereby is d1rected to mail notice, 1n the manner and form prescribed by law, of the adoption of this resolutlon to all persons owing real property in the here1nbefore described assessment district, whose names and addresses appear on the last equalized assessment roll for city taxes or as known to the C1ty Clerk. SECTION 5. That 1f the property owner does not notify the City w1th1n 15 days after the public hearing that he will do the work h1mself then the City will commence the reqU1red work. SECTION 6. The City Clerk shall certify to the adoption of this resolutlon and thenceforth and thereafter the same shall be in full force and effect.
